Subject: Crash pipeline catching up — watch tonight

Hey release folks,

Quick note for whoever's on call: the Tumblefin crash-report pipeline fell behind after this afternoon's ingest spike, so symbolicated reports for the new Lanternbay build may lag a few hours. Nothing's lost — the queue is draining. If you see duplicate crash groups, don't panic, dedupe runs at midnight. Should you need to page the pipeline team, quote the build token below.

pipeline stamp: htk9_ce63042d9

- [ ] Sketchloom key ceremony: rotate the signing key for the undo/redo history service before the 4.2 release cut. Heads up — the redo stack serializer is picky, so snapshot user histories first and run the replay check. Once both witnesses sign off, stash the escrow card; its recovery passphrase goes right below this line.

unlock words, fawif-hahip: eliax-ulador-holdor-novix-prawyn-norius-kelax-weniel-alddor-ulaion

Ticket: slimming the Cobbleworth base images went fine (down to ~60MB), but the build vault that holds our registry signing key locked itself after the CI migration. Future maintainers: if the vault throws the lockout banner again, don't panic and don't re-enroll the runner. Just unlock it with the passphrase below.

unlock words, yawig-kagef: gordor-holvan-ulaael-pramir-ulaiel-tamdor

# Paysprocket integration test env — eng sync notes
# Flaky suite traced to sandbox token expiry mid-run.
# Fix: refresh token at suite start, not per test.
# Retries capped at 2; anything beyond that, file a ticket.
# Do not reuse prod config here.
# The sandbox gateway credential for this suite is set on the next line.

vault entry, yahif-yajep: COURIER_KEY29=b802bdf8034096b65a51c6ba5abe2